ios单例模式优缺点 单例模式和全局静态变量(类)的区别?
单例模式和全局静态变量(类)的区别?1. 单例特性:确保只有一个类的唯一实例存在。类本身初始化自身。获取唯一实例的方法非常清楚。可以通过类本身定义的静态方法getInstance()获取类的唯一实例引
单例模式和全局静态变量(类)的区别?
1. 单例特性:确保只有一个类的唯一实例存在。
类本身初始化自身。获取唯一实例的方法非常清楚。可以通过类本身定义的静态方法getInstance()获取类的唯一实例引用。2静态变量定义类的实例引用特性:类实例引用的静态变量可以在任何文档类中定义。获取类实例引用的静态变量。您可以定义静态变量的类名,并通过点语法访问引用。静态变量可以在任何位置重新赋值。Singleton模式是对静态变量模式下创建类实例引用的缺陷的改进